    Can you put a plate in a toaster oven?

    If you’re wondering whether you can put a plate in a toaster oven, the answer is yes! However, there are a few things to keep in mind. First, make sure that the plate is oven-safe. If it’s not, it could crack or break when exposed to high heat. Second, be sure to put the plate on the rack in the toaster oven so that it’s not touching the heating element. And finally, don’t put anything on top of the plate while it’s in the toaster oven, as this could cause it to topple over and break. With these tips in mind, you can safely and successfully use your toaster oven to reheat a plate of food.

    Are there any risks associated with putting a plate in a toaster oven?

    There are a few risks associated with putting a plate in a toaster oven. The most serious risk is that the plate could break and shards of glass could end up in your food. This could cause serious injury or even death. Additionally, the heat from the toaster oven could cause the plate to crack or shatter, again causing shards of glass to end up in your food. Finally, if the plate is not heat-resistant, it could melt or catch fire, causing damage to your toaster oven and potentially starting a kitchen fire.
